AI Grading Assistant for Canvas Discussions 🎓📝

This application is designed to be the best friend of a grading assistant for Canvas discussions. It uses advanced AI models to grade student responses based on a provided rubric, and also provides developmental feedback to students. The application is built using Next.js and the Vercel AI SDK, with added Azure Authentication.

Features 🚀

  • Assisted Grading: The application aids in grading Canvas discussions based on a provided rubric, saving educators valuable time.
  • Developmental Feedback: In addition to grading, the application provides feedback to students, helping them understand how they can improve.
  • Easy to Use: Simply provide the URL of the Canvas discussion and your Canvas API Key, and the application will handle the rest.
  • Azure Authentication: The application is secured with Azure Authentication, ensuring only authorized users can access it.

How to Use 🛠️

  1. Login: Use your Azure credentials to login to the application.
  2. Ingest Canvas Discussions: Enter your Canvas Discussion URL and your Canvas API Key, then click the 'Ingest' button. The application will download the discussion data and prepare it for grading.
  3. Start Grading: Once the data has been ingested, click the 'Grade' button to start the grading process. The application will assist in grading each student's response based on the provided rubric.
  4. Download Results: After grading is complete, you can download the results as a CSV file. This file contains the grades for each student, along with the feedback provided by the application.
  5. Ask Questions: You can ask questions about the grading process or the results. The application uses an AI model to provide answers to your questions.

Running the Application 🏃‍♀️

To run the application, you need to install the dependencies and start the development server:

pnpm install
pnpm run dev

This will launch the application, where you can interact with it on http://localhost:3000.
